[float] === {Beats} https://www.elastic.co/products/beats/auditbeat[{auditbeat}], https://www.elastic.co/products/beats/filebeat[{filebeat}], https://www.elastic.co/products/beats/winlogbeat[{winlogbeat}], and https://www.elastic.co/products/beats/packetbeat[{packetbeat}] send security events and other data to Elasticsearch. The default index patterns for Elastic Security events are `auditbeat-*`, `winlogbeat-*`, `filebeat-*`, `packetbeat-*`, `endgame-*`, `logs-*`, and `apm-*-transaction*`. To change the default pattern patterns, go to *Stack Management > Advanced Settings > securitySolution:defaultIndex*. [float] === Elastic Security endpoint agent The agent detects and protects against malware, and ships host and network events directly to Elastic Security. [float] === Elastic Common Schema (ECS) for normalizing data The {ecs-ref}[Elastic Common Schema (ECS)] defines a common set of fields to be used for storing event data in Elasticsearch. ECS helps users normalize their event data to better analyze, visualize, and correlate the data represented in their events. Elastic Security can ingest and normalize events from ECS-compatible data sources. -- include::siem-ui.asciidoc[] include::machine-learning.asciidoc[]
